389573-07-3,184007-56-5,184017-91-2,857296-84-5,562080-95-9,39746-49-1 Supplier | CHEMOLED.COM
CMO CDMO service. CHEMOLED.COM supply 389573-07-3,184007-56-5,184017-91-2,857296-84-5,562080-95-9,39746-49-1 and related compounds.
562080-95-9 184007-56-5 389573-07-3 857296-84-5 39746-49-1 184017-91-2